We’re Top Ranked again!

We are delighted that Travlaw has once again been top ranked  in the 2023 edition of Chambers!

We are humbled to once again have been recognised by both the industry and peers as being leading players in both:

  • Travel: Regulatory & Commercial;
  • Travel: International Personal Injury (Defendant).

It is particularly pleasing to keep a “#1” next to our name in the Regulatory & Commercial category This shows that what we suspected here is indeed the case, i.e. that Travlaw are a number one choice when it comes to travel law needs.

On top of that, Senior Counsel Stephen Mason has been named the country’s top Travel Lawyer, again(!), in the Regulatory & Commercial sphere. Senior Partner Matt Gatenby is also a ranked lawyer, and we believe many of our top, top team will not be too far behind.
